[Ann] Warehouse management app for Dynamics 365 SCM is in Public Preview

The day has come when we are ready for Public preview of the reworked Warehouse management app. 

Summary

The Warehouse Management app is a complete remake, using the “frontline worker” visual style, as seen in Production floor execution and HoloLens Guide. The new design concepts are based on extensive usability studies including a broad worker population. The solution is designed to help workers be more efficient, productive, and better able to complete work accurately.

The new solution provides the following benefits and capabilities:

  • Faster task execution
    • “Spinner” for fast quantity input
    • Buttons easy to hit with gloves
    • Clear text on dirty screens
    • Buttons in best corner for user’s grip
  • Easier ramp-up of temp workers
    • Title and illustration per step
    • Full-screen photo to verify product
  • Solves top user pain points
    • Menu hard to use
    • Gray text hard to read
    • Hard to learn what step means
  • Settings sync’ed from FnO
    • Instruction per task step, company can edit
  • Great foundation for next steps
    • Meets WCAG 2.1 accessibility with focus on situational disabilities
      • Scales text to 400%
      • Scales buttons to 200%
    • Scaling to fit any device type
      • Based on resulting sizes of elements
      • Swaps parts
      • Changes layout sequence

Warehouse Mobile Devices Portal - Now as an App for your mobile device

Our team has been working on an application that would eventually replace the existing web-site based Warehouse Mobile Devices Portal (WMDP), as we see the trend of warehouses relying more and more on phone-based devices with added scanner capabilities (Honeywell Dolphin 75e, for example).

We are happy to announce that the app is now publicly available.
Installation and configuration instructions,  as well as download links, can be found on the Dynamics 365 for Operations wiki website:
https://ax.help.dynamics.com/en/wiki/install-and-configure-dynamics-365-for-operations-warehousing/

The app works on Windows 10 devices, as well as Android devices. iOS is not supported, since such devices are generally not used in warehouses due to high cost and some technical limitations.

The app only works with Dynamics 365 for Operations, so older releases like AX 2012 R3 can only use the old WMDP web site.

The app is an alternative front-end to all the business logic and screen generation logic in X++, so does not contain any business logic inside, similar to the old WMDP.

As you will see, we have re-worked the user interface, focusing on showing as few controls as possible at once, adding cards for showing grouped data like on-hand info, work list, etc. A special keyboard to entering quantities, support for scanning, etc.
